区块链安全:解析漏洞与防范策略
区块链技术作为一种去中心化、不可篡改的分布式账本系统,因其安全性而备受关注。然而,尽管区块链被认为是相对安全的技术,但仍存在各种潜在的漏洞和安全隐患。在探讨区块链黑客漏洞的我们也将探讨如何应对和预防这些潜在的威胁。
区块链漏洞类型
1.
智能合约漏洞
:智能合约是区块链上执行的自动化合约代码,存在编程错误可能导致资金被盗。最著名的案例是2016年的“DAO攻击”,导致以太坊网络硬分叉。2.
双重支付
:在某些区块链上,存在攻击者通过发送同一笔资金两次的漏洞,这可能破坏交易的不可逆性。3.
共识算法攻击
:某些共识算法可能受到攻击,例如51%攻击,其中攻击者控制网络的算力超过51%,从而能够篡改交易记录。4.
隐私漏洞
:虽然区块链上的交易通常是公开的,但某些隐私币可能受到攻击,揭示用户的身份或交易信息。如何预防区块链漏洞
1.
审计智能合约
:在部署智能合约之前,进行全面的代码审计是至关重要的。使用自动化工具和人工审查来识别潜在的漏洞和错误。2.
多重签名技术
:在交易中使用多重签名技术可以增加安全性,需要多个私钥才能完成交易,从而降低了单点故障的风险。3.
加强共识算法
:选择具有高度安全性和抗攻击性的共识算法,并确保网络的去中心化程度足够高,以降低攻击成功的可能性。4.
隐私保护措施
:对于需要保护隐私的交易,应该使用隐私币或加密技术来确保用户身份和交易信息的机密性。最佳实践和建议
教育用户
:加强用户对区块链安全的认识,提供有关如何安全地使用区块链和加密货币的培训和指南。
定期更新
:定期更新区块链软件和相关应用程序,以确保及时修补已知漏洞和安全问题。
社区合作
:加强区块链社区的合作与沟通,共同应对潜在的安全威胁,共享最佳实践和安全经验。
建立应急响应计划
:制定详细的应急响应计划,以便在发生安全事件时能够及时应对和处理,最大限度地减少损失。结论
尽管区块链技术具有相当高的安全性,但仍然存在各种潜在的漏洞和安全隐患。通过采取适当的预防措施和最佳实践,可以降低这些风险,并使区块链网络更加安全可靠。继续关注安全领域的最新发展,并持续改进安全措施,将有助于建立一个更加安全的区块链生态系统。
点击[此处]()查看更多关于区块链安全的信息。
这篇文章是为您提供的一份详尽的指南,希望能够帮助您更好地了解区块链安全的重要性以及如何应对潜在的漏洞和威胁。
标签: 区块链黑洞是什么 区块链黑洞是什么意思 区块链会被黑客攻击吗
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。